Ceramica Cleopatra have made the strongest start in their Egyptian Premier League history after collecting 12 points from their opening five matches of the 2026-27 season.
Ali Maher’s side have won four of those games and lost once, leaving them temporarily at the top of the table.
Ceramica Cleopatra are also the league’s leading scorers so far, with 10 goals from five matches – an average of two goals per game.
The club had never taken more than eight points from its first five fixtures since gaining promotion to the top flight. Their current tally therefore represents their best start since reaching the Egyptian Premier League.
Ceramica Cleopatra opened the campaign with a defeat by newly promoted Al Qanah before responding with victories over Al Ittihad Alexandria, Modern Sport, Smouha and, most recently, National Bank of Egypt.
Their points totals after five matches in each season since promotion are:
– 2020-21: 8 points – 2021-22: 8 points – 2022-23: 6 points – 2023-24: 4 points – 2024-25: 8 points – 2025-26: 7 points – 2026-27: 12 points
